International Aviation Developments

Algeria marked a significant diplomatic milestone with the resumption of direct flights to Budapest, as Ambassador Adel Talbi oversaw the reception of the first Air Algerie flight at Budapest Airport. The delegation included representatives from Algeria's Ministry of Foreign Affairs and Hungary's ambassador to Algeria, signaling strengthened bilateral relations and economic cooperation between the two nations.

Urban Transportation Modernization

Vietnam has achieved a major construction milestone in Ho Chi Minh City's ambitious metro expansion, with the second metro line reaching the vicinity of Tan Son Nhat International Airport. Beginning April 4, authorities implemented a major intersection closure to facilitate underground station construction, representing a crucial component of the city's long-term transportation strategy.

The project addresses the current three-hour journey between downtown Ho Chi Minh City and the airport, with plans to reduce travel time to 30 minutes through integrated high-speed rail connections. This development supports Vietnam's broader $120 billion commitment to construct 9,000 kilometers of expressways by 2050, positioning the country as a Southeast Asian logistics hub.

Technology Disruptions and Resilience

New Zealand experienced significant transportation disruptions when a major Auckland Transport (AT) system outage suspended all train services during Thursday morning rush hour. Operations resumed around 10:15 AM, but the incident highlighted the critical dependence of modern transportation networks on digital infrastructure.

The disruption affected thousands of commuters and demonstrated both the vulnerabilities and rapid recovery capabilities of contemporary transit systems. Energy Costs Impact Transportation Access

Rising fuel prices are creating accessibility challenges for educational institutions, as demonstrated by New Zealand's Whare Wānanga o Awanuiārangi moving classes online due to student concerns about transportation costs. The Whakatāne-based institution relocated two noho (residential learning programs) to virtual formats and is evaluating additional courses on a case-by-case basis.

This development illustrates how global energy market volatility directly impacts educational access and social mobility, forcing institutions to adapt delivery methods to maintain inclusivity.
